Question 1036265: In Bio 111 class you learned that human hair can vary in diameter, but one es timate of the average diameter is 50 microns. How many 10 nanometer particles could be stacked across the diameter of a human hair?

1 micron = 1 x 10^-6
1 nanometre = 1 x 10^-9
So, 50 x 10^-6/10 x 10^-9
= 5,000.
This the number of 10 nanometer
particles that could be stacked
across the diameter(50 x 10^-6)
of a human hair.
